(PERI) closed at $8.66, down 3.56% on the session, as selling pressure pushed the stock toward its identified support level near $8.23. The decline comes amid broader sector weakness and places the stock in a technically sensitive zone where a break below support could open the door to further downside, while a bounce may target resistance at $9.09.

The $8.66 close represents a decline of approximately 31 cents from the prior session, a move that was accompanied by elevated volume compared to recent averages. This suggests heightened conviction among sellers, potentially driven by company-specific news or shifts in sentiment within the digital advertising and technology services sector. Perion Network, which provides digital advertising solutions and performance optimization technology, operates in a competitive landscape where market participants closely scrutinize quarterly earnings, guidance, and macroeconomic factors such as ad spending trends. The current price action indicates that investors may be reassessing the company’s near-term growth trajectory, particularly given the stock's year-to-date decline. At $8.66, PERI is trading closer to its 52-week low than its high, reflecting persistent headwinds. The session’s move broke below recent congestion around $8.85–$9.00, signaling that sellers remain in control. Without a catalyst to reverse momentum, the stock may continue to test lower levels. On a positive note, such declines sometimes attract bargain hunters or short-term traders seeking a bounce, but the volume spike suggests that distribution is currently outweighing accumulation. From a technical perspective, PERI is hovering just above its near-term support at $8.23, a level that has historically acted as a floor during previous pullbacks. A close below this zone could expose the stock to further depreciation, possibly toward $7.50–$7.70, where prior lows from earlier in the year provide a secondary support band. On the upside, resistance at $9.09 remains a critical hurdle; a reclaim of that level would be needed to suggest that selling pressure is abating. The stock's 50-day moving average is likely sloping downward and resides well above the current price, indicating a bearish medium-term trend. Momentum oscillators such as the relative strength index (RSI) are probably in the mid-30s range, reflecting oversold conditions that may occasionally produce short-term bounces. However, oversold readings alone do not guarantee reversals, especially in a declining trend. The price action shows a series of lower highs and lower lows over the past several weeks, consistent with a downtrend. Volume analysis reveals that rallies have been characterized by lighter participation, while declines attract heavier turnover, a classic pattern of distribution. Looking ahead, Perion Network’s next moves may hinge on whether it can hold above the $8.23 support level. If the stock stabilizes and volume contracts in the coming sessions, it could potentially attempt a recovery toward the $9.09 resistance area. A successful break above $9.09 might signal a shift in sentiment, but would likely require a positive catalyst such as better-than-expected earnings, a strategic partnership, or an industry-wide uplift. Conversely, if the $8.23 support gives way on high volume, PERI could re-test the $7.50–$7.70 region or lower. Factors to watch include any upcoming quarterly reports, management commentary on ad spending trends, and broad market conditions affecting growth stocks. The company’s financial health—cash flows, debt levels, and revenue diversification—will also influence investor confidence. A prolonged period of consolidation near support may indicate accumulation by long-term investors, but for now, the path of least resistance appears to be downward. Traders and investors should monitor volume patterns and key level breaks for signs of either a capitulation bottom or a continuation of the decline.
